Scottish Premiership roundup: Aberdeen beat Motherwell to extend lead at the top

Aberdeen beat Motherwell 2-0 to open up a four-point lead at the top of the Scottish Premiership, while Inverness Caledonian Thistle and Hamilton Academical also record victories.

Aberdeen have beaten Motherwell to open up a four-point lead at the top of the Scottish Premiership this afternoon.

Adam Rooney's double gave the Dons a 2-0 victory and extended their winning run in the league to seven games.

Hamilton Academical made it successive wins at the start of the New Year by beating St Johnstone 1-0.

Tony Andreu's 13th goal of the season settled the contest, with James McFadden seeing a red card late on for the hosts.

Bottom of the league Ross County survived the 10th-minute dismissal of Terry Dunfield to earn a 1-1 draw at Dundee.

The Dees took the lead shortly after the break through Jim McAlister's goal, but Craig Curran hit back to salvage a point for the visitors.

At Firhill Stadium, Partick Thistle and Dundee United played out a four-goal thriller, with their match ending in a 2-2 draw.

Gary Mackay-Steven struck early on for the visitors, but goals from Ryan Stevenson and Kris Doolan saw the hosts go into the break leading.

With 18 minutes left Nadir Ciftci scored a second for United to keep them in fourth place and just one point behind Celtic.

Meanwhile, Inverness Caledonian Thistle edged to a 1-0 victory over St Mirren thanks to Billy McKay's late goal.

Results in full: Dundee 1-1 Ross County, Inverness Caledonian Thistle 1-0 St Mirren, Partick Thistle 2-2 Dundee United, St Johnstone 0-1 Hamilton Academical, Motherwell 0-2 Aberdeen
